Over the years, academic success has been the subject of discussion for academics and scholars. Even though it can mean different things to different people, academic success is generally used to talk about meeting educational goals and describing what students accomplish by participating in formal education programs. It is also generally agreed that doing well in academic life is important because the experience equips scholars with the abilities and the knowledge needed to grow both personally and professionally.1
Besides students, academic institutions also view students’ academic success as a measure for their own performance. If the goal to earn a degree is a journey, the academic institution is the vehicle used to cover that journey. Continual evaluation of students and offering them assistance wherever required can help in course correction and also improve their academic success rate.2
Various measures are used to gauge academic success. These include grades, test scores, and completion rates, its role in shaping individuals for future success is crucial. Let us explore what academic success means.
As discussed earlier, measuring academic success is commonly associated with achieving academic goals, including completing courses and programs, earning good grades, and gaining knowledge and skills for career growth. An indirect but larger result of academic success of scholars is collective personal development, which in turn contributes to the overall well-being of society.
While defining academic success is about excelling in coursework and examinations, it also encompasses the development of critical thinking, problem-solving skills, and a passion for learning. True academic success is an all-encompassing concept, which that goes over and beyond the numeric representation of grades, focusing on the overall growth and development of individuals and of people as a whole.3
Academic success is not about focusing on one or two tasks. It is a mix of a lot of different things. For example, it is important to set achievable, short- and long-term goals. Along with this you also need to manage your time, have good study habits, stay resilient, and make a study plan that works for you. All these together help you keep track of how you’re doing, and help you stay on course to achieve what you’ve planned.
